Pottawatomie Jail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Pottawatomie Jail in the United States is $80,903.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$39. Salaries at Pottawatomie Jail typically range from $70,724 to $92,625 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Oklahoma City?

Understanding the cost of living near Oklahoma City is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Pottawatomie Jail.
Oklahoma City's Cost of Living Index is approximately 85.4 (14.6% less expensive than US average; 1.9% less than OK average). State capital, growing, affordable housing. EMBARK bus/streetcar.
